When to give gifts to my parents?

MrsE2020, on February 18, 2020 at 11:22 AM Posted in Etiquette and Advice 0 5

So to start off, we are giving gifts to those in the wedding party but we aren't doing a big gift presentation, we are giving the gifts as we see them the day before the wedding (most are staying at the same hotel so we didn't want to drag the gifts in an uber and have the guests have to drag them back). We are having a get together with the wedding party and some close friends after the rehearsal so that the wedding party can get to know each other before the wedding.

My parents have contributed some to the wedding so we want to get them a gift but would it be inappropriate to take them to dinner when we get back and give them a gift then? I don't think they are actually expecting anything and I don't recall ever seeing gifts presented to parents in any of the weddings I have been in.

His mom and sister aren't able to attend and haven't contributed (we didn't ask them to) but we will give them a photo album after we get our pics back.
